cfgraph

This tag is deprecated. Use the cfchart, cfchartdata, and cfchartseries tags instead.

Displays data graphically.

ColdFusion MX: Deprecated this tag. It works differently than it did in ColdFusion 5, and it might not work in later releases.

The incompatibilities between the ColdFusion MX implementation and earlier implementations of this tag are as follows:

cfgraph tag attribute ColdFusion MX functionality

Title

Ignored

Titlefont

Ignored

Barspacing

Ignored

Bordercolor

Color used for border, gridlines, and text displays

Colorlist

  • Pie chart: list of colors to use for each data point
  • Other chart types: ignored

Valuelabelfont

Sets value label text font. If the Valuelabelfont, Itemlabelfont, and Legendfont values differ, ColdFusion uses the last value that you specify in the tag.

Arial is not supported; it is mapped to Dialog.

Itemlabelfont

Sets item label text font. If the Valuelabelfont, Itemlabelfont, and Legendfont values differ, ColdFusion uses the last value that you specify in the tag

Arial is not supported; it is mapped to Dialog.

Legendfont

Sets legend text font. If the Valuelabelfont, Itemlabelfont, and Legendfont values differ, ColdFusion uses the last value that you specify in the tag

Arial is not supported; it is mapped to Dialog.

ShowLegend

  • above, below, left, right: these options cause the legend to display, but have no effect on its location.
  • none: prevents display of a legend

Valuelabelsize

Sets value label text size. If the Valuelabelsize and Itemlabelsize values differ, ColdFusion uses the last value that you specify in the tag

Itemlabelsize

Sets item label text size

Itemlabelorientation

Ignored. ColdFusion calculates best orientation based on label and graph size.

Borderwidth

  • a non-zero number: default-width border, regardless of number value
  • 0: no border

Depth

  • 0: displays graph with two-dimensional appearance
  • any other value: displays graph with threedimensional appearance

Linewidth

Ignored

Showvaluelabel

  • yes: displays values on mouse-click;
  • no: suppresses value displays
  • rollover: displays values on mouse-over.

Valuelocation

Ignored

url

URL of page to open if any item in the graph is clicked.

The following variables may be used within the URL; they are substituted with real values before the URL is accessed:

  • "$value$": selected row/column value or an empty string
  • "$itemlabel$": selected item (column) value or an empty string
  • "$serieslabel$": selected series (row) value or an empty string
  • "javascript:...": executes client side scripts.

Urlcolumn

Ignored.

This attribute generates a graph, but the url link is missing data that the linked page may expect. Thus, drilling-down in the graph may result in an error.

Type="HorizontalBar"

The (0,0) coordinate is located at the lower-left.

ScaleFrom

If the smallest value in the data is less than scaleFrom or the largest value in the data is greater than scaleTo, the respective data value is used as the minimum or maximum on the Y scale. Therefore, regardless of the scaleFrom or scaleTo value, all data values display.
